What are plastic trays for plants?
Plastic trays are shallow containers made out of durable plastic that gardeners use to grow plants, flowers, shrubs, and vegetables. They are available in different sizes and shapes to suit various gardening needs. Plastic trays for plants provide an excellent housing environment for small and delicate rooted plants, ensuring optimal growth and protection.

Benefits of using Plastic Trays for Plants
Using plastic trays for plants carries several advantages, including:
1. Protects Plants
Plastic trays for plants shield plants from harsh weather elements such as extreme sunlight, frost, rain, and wind. These trays are also useful for keeping away pests and garden animals that compromise plant safety and productivity.
2. Easy to Clean and Reuse
Unlike other planting containers that require extensive cleaning after use, plastic trays are easy to wash and maintain. Gardeners can easily rinse and dry them under the sun before reuse, even during different growing seasons. This feature makes them cost-effective and ideal for repeat plant cycles.
3. Helps with Water Drainage
The plastic trays' design helps excess water escape from the plants' roots, reducing the risk of root rot and overall damage to the plant. This feature guarantees optimal nutrient absorption, leading to robust plant growth.
4. Prevents Mess and Disorder
Using plastic trays in gardening ensures an orderly and clean environment for plant growth, maintenance, and harvesting. Growing plants in trays help minimize clutter, foot traffic destruction, and promote well-organized and efficient space utilization.
Different Types of Plastic Trays for Plants
Here are some of the types of plastic trays:
1. Garden Trays for Plants
Similar to other plastic trays, garden trays come in varying sizes and shapes, but they are commonly shallow and large enough to contain several small pots or plants. They are perfect when dealing with many plants and still need a cost-effective way to care for them.
2. Small Plant Trays
These trays are ideal for seedlings and small rooted plants. Due to their smaller size, they require only minimal watering, making them manageable for novice gardeners.
3. Large Plastic Trays
Large plastic trays are efficient in growing large crops of vegetables or flowers within limited spaces. They are deeper than standard trays and can support different plant heights, including taller ones that regular trays may not accommodate.

FAQ
Here are some frequently asked questions about using plastic trays in gardening:
What is the best size of plastic tray for small plants?
For optimal growth and health, choose trays that are suitable for the plant's root ball size. Small plants do well in shallow trays that are at least two inches deep.
Can plastic trays be reused?
Yes. Plastic trays are durable and easy to clean and can be used for several growing seasons.
What is the role of drainage holes in plastic trays?
Drainage holes on plastic trays prevent waterlogging and excess water retention that would otherwise destroy plant roots, affect nutrient absorption, and promote mold growth.
Are plastic trays durable enough to withstand harsh weather?
Yes. Plastic trays that are well-maintained can withstand harsh weather elements such as extreme sun, wind, and rain.
How often should I clean my plastic plant trays?
Clean plastic trays immediately after using them or at least once a week. This helps prevent mold buildup, pest infestation, and cross-contamination of diseases that affect plants.
Do all plants require plastic trays to grow well?
No. While plastic trays offer beneficial gardening solutions, not all plants require them to grow optimally. For instance, cacti and succulents thrive in dry soils that drain water quickly, while others such as ferns grow better with high humidity.
